Deregulation of authorisations to process personal data

The government plans to abolish the obligation in the Labour Code and the Whistleblower Protection Act to give authorization in writing to process personal.

Currently, authorisation is required for persons:

  • processing special categories of personal data (article 221b § 3 of the Labour Code),
  • handling internal reports and taking follow-up action (article 27(2) of the Whistleblower Protection Act).

The proposed amendment abolishes the requirement for authorisations to be in writing, permitting them to be documented in any form, provided that accountability is maintained in accordance with the GDPR.
